Swan Hellenic has revealed an exciting increase in bookings for its 2026-2027 and 2027-2028 Antarctic seasons, following a record-breaking 2025-2026 season. The company has reported a 53% rise in the number of guests and a 66% increase in net revenue, marking a significant boost for luxury expedition cruise tourism in the polar regions. The upcoming Antarctic seasons will feature 33 voyages in 2026-2027 and 34 voyages in 2027-2028, attracting travelers eager to explore one of the last unspoiled frontiers on earth in style.

The growing popularity of Swan Hellenic’s Antarctic cruises reflects the rising demand for luxury, eco-conscious travel experiences in remote destinations. The company’s use of advanced Polar-Class 5 ice-class ships allows for exclusive access to some of Antarctica’s most pristine and less-visited areas, setting a new standard in polar expedition tourism.

Expanding Antarctica’s Appeal with New Destinations and Grand Voyages

The 2026-2027 season will offer 33 voyages, including 29 round-trip expeditions from Ushuaia, Argentina, lasting between 9 to 17 days, plus 4 grand voyages. The following 2027-2028 season will continue this trend with a total of 34 voyages. Swan Hellenic’s Polar-Class Ships Lead the Way in Antarctic Exploration

At the heart of Swan Hellenic’s success in Antarctic luxury cruising is its fleet of Polar-Class 5 ice-class ships, including the SH Minerva and SH Vega. These highly capable vessels are specifically designed to navigate sea ice and brash ice up to 1.2 meters thick, providing guests with exclusive access to some of the most remote Antarctic locations. These ships’ advanced capabilities allow for itineraries that would be impossible for most other cruise lines to offer.
